Title: Inside Linebackers

Jack Ruetty begins his second season on the staff at Ohio Dominican as the inside linebackers coach.

Ruetty comes to ODU after spending six years at nearby Capital University. In 2008, he coached the Gene Slaughter Award winner, which is given annually to the top linebacker in the OAC, and also coached two more All-OAC selections in 2009.

Ruetty spent 29 years as an assistant coach at Marysville, Dublin Coffman and Dublin Scioto High Schools, and he taught algebra, geometry and computer applications at Marysville. During his time at Marysville, Ruetty coached Chase Blackburn, a current member of the New York Giants who helped the team to a victory in Super Bowl XLII.

Ruetty graduated from Muskingum College in 1976, where he played football and was a teammate of ODU offensive line coach Scott McIntire.
